Animal Liberation Orchestra (ALO)

Fly Between Walls

2006-04-19

This Jack Johnson-backed project out of San Fransisco debut their funky-pop sound on their first release Fly Between Walls. ALO lends a quiet, quirky, and fun sound to their tunes, provided by surfer guitar-pluckings and sweet melodies. Fans of other Brushfire Records projects should readily accept this dynamic band which has become the darlings of the West Coast underground scene. Tracks of interest include their first single #3 “Girl, I Wanna Lay You Down”, #1 “Spectrum”, and #5 “Walls Of Jericho”. – Ryan Terpstra
